What will I learn?

Get the skills and training you need to work in the booming construction industry. Learn the specialized construction project management planning process and to be able to work collaboratively within multi-disciplinary teams that consist of project managers, architects, engineers, regulators, environmental consultants, and contractors. Entry requirements

For international students

Students must have Ontario College Diploma, Ontario College Advanced Diploma, Degree, or equivalent. Applicants must have a community college diploma or degree in a construction-related field or the equivalent.
